This section describes how to test network connectivity for Windows and
Linux networks.
Here are the guidelines to testing the network connectivity:
Verify Both the adapter and the switch must be set to the same
duplex mode and the same supported speed.
Before entering the ping command, disconnect or disable all other
network connections. Otherwise, the ping command may succeed
through the network connection that you do not intend to test.
To test the network connectivity for the Windows driver software, perform
the following procedure.
Use the ping command to determine if network connectivity is working.
1. Click the icon at the left bottom corner of the Windows.
2. In the search box, type cmd and click OK.
3. Type ipconfig /all
The command window opens, as shown in Figure 41.
